Alright, so, our chat has gone through a looooooot of changes, especially in recent months/years. Now, finally, we think we've found something that works. What is it you may ask? Discord, a voice and text chat service similar to Teamspeak or Mumble. Now I know what you're thinking, we just had a perfectly adequate IRC chat, so...
Why should I care?
In no particular order:
- It's completely free.
- It supports both high quality voice chat and plain text chat.
- Huge cross-platform support:
- Web version if you don't want to or can't download anything.
- Windows, Mac, and Linux clients if you're a desktop kinda guy.
- Android and iOS apps for your mobile needs.
- Ridiculous customization:
- Want a darker or lighter theme? You got it.
- Want to turn notifications on or off? Yup, that's a thing too.
- Do you want to change your name, let others see when you're playing games on steam, or even have new messages read out loud to you by text-to-speech? You better believe there's options for all of that.
- Images and youtube videos preview in chat, this can be turned off.
- We manage our own channel directly, no going through a middleman.
- We can control troublemakers (this is an ENORMOUS benefit over IRC).
- You can be connected to multiple servers, and multiple channels per server:
- To add onto this, you can even talk in one voice channel while typing in a text channel- even if they're on completely different servers.
- It is still in development and is constantly seeing improvements based on ideas suggested by the users.
- That's right, you can actively participate in making it even better.
- Official bot API to be released eventually.
- There's even a widget to embed it on the forums.
- Literally everyone on the IRC has already made the move- what are you waiting for?
So what's the catch?
Well... There isn't one. Discord takes the good features from all our previous chats- high quality, lightweight voice chat from Mumble; the accessibility of IRC; and the logging capabilities of Skype- and rolls them all together. If you really want something to complain about, there are a few things these other programs do better. It doesn't have video calls like Skype, and you're a bit more limited than an IRC, but the vast majority of users who have tried it agree that this is hardly a dealbreaker. And again, it's still in development, so maybe we'll see those features in the future.

- Do not post threatening, hateful, obscene, or illegal material. Children use this site, and we don't need a lawsuit.
- Name changes are allowed in moderation, but you must be recognizable. This can be as simple as using your forum avatar.
- Be polite. Spamming, flaming, and impersonating another user will not be tolerated.
- Chat users should be registered and not banned on the Runouw forums. If your friend wants to join, encourage them to register first. We don't bite :p
- Use common sense. If it isn't allowed on the forums, don't do it on the chat either. If you're unsure about anything, ask around first. Failure to comply may result in being kicked from the channel; severe cases may result in a ban.

Text Formatting:
These can be used together to make produce multiple simultaneous effects.
- *italic text*
- **bold text**
- __underline text__
- ~~strikethrough text~~
Contacting Other Users:
Typing @Nickname will send a ping to user Nickname.
Typing @everyone will send a ping to everyone connected to the server, don't abuse it.
If you need to contact someone who is not online, you can private message them by clicking their name on the right side of the chat window, and then clicking the blue Message button. They will see it when they come online next.
